Grassland AnimalsBlack Rhino

The male rhino can be 91/2 feet tall at shoulders

They live alone, except for mothers and young

Its upper lip is pointed and moveable Which helps it to eat

leaves, buds, and shoots of small trees and bushes.

Found in African grasslands
